Output 37966c81b0ac0802b5b566c61d3c378b569b2e84b2b32f1286f6997df3a36de4:139

value
118394
script pubkey
OP_0 OP_PUSHBYTES_32 9181fa135163735712ec8640130ac4d70af7bf190809c854bb17bcf40114bd3a
address
bc1qjxql5y63vde4wyhvseqpxzky6u9000cepqyus49mz770gqg5h5aqgn983c
transaction
37966c81b0ac0802b5b566c61d3c378b569b2e84b2b32f1286f6997df3a36de4
spent
true